Assisted Living Costs in Hudsonville, Michigan
When considering assisted living options in Hudsonville, Michigan, one of the primary considerations for many families is the cost. Assisted living facilities provide a range of services that cater to individuals who need assistance with daily activities but wish to maintain a level of independence. These services come at a price, which varies depending on the level of care required and the amenities offered by the facility.
In Hudsonville, the cost of assisted living is somewhat higher than the Michigan state average. While data indicates that the median monthly cost for assisted living homes in Michigan was around $4,250, Hudsonville's average cost is approximately $6,211 per month. This figure can fluctuate based on the specific services a resident may need, the type of accommodation chosen, and the facility's location within the Hudsonville area.
It's important to note that these costs are generally all-inclusive, covering room and board, meals, utilities, and most daily activities and care. However, additional services may incur extra charges, so it's crucial for families to thoroughly understand what is included in the base cost when comparing facilities.
For those concerned about managing these expenses, it's worth exploring whether there are government support programs available. In Michigan, eligible seniors may have access to options such as Medicaid or other state-specific programs designed to help cover the costs of assisted living. Qualifying for such assistance typically depends on the individual's financial situation and care needs.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Hudsonville Michigan
When considering long-term care options in Hudsonville, Michigan, it's important to understand the differences between Assisted Living, Memory Care, Nursing Home, and Independent Living facilities. Each offers unique services tailored to varying levels of individual needs.
Assisted Living facilities provide residents with personal care support services such as meals, medication management, bathing, dressing, and transportation. These communities are designed for individuals who require assistance with daily activities but do not need the full-time health care services a nursing home provides.
Memory Care units, often located within assisted living facilities, offer specialized care for individuals with Alzheimer's disease, dementia, and other memory impairments. These facilities have structured programs, activities, and secure environments to prevent wandering and ensure the safety of residents with memory loss.
Nursing Homes, also known as Skilled Nursing Facilities, cater to residents who require 24-hour medical care and assistance with every aspect of daily life. They offer a higher level of care compared to assisted living, including medical monitoring and treatments, physical therapy, and a range of rehabilitative services.
Independent Living communities are ideal for seniors who are still active and independent but prefer living in a community setting with other seniors. These communities often provide amenities such as fitness centers, housekeeping services, and community activities, with the convenience of maintenance-free living.
In Hudsonville, Michigan, each type of facility caters to the specific needs of its residents, from those who cherish their independence to those who require dedicated medical attention. It's crucial to assess the level of care needed and consider both the short-term and long-term requirements when choosing the right facility for yourself or a loved one.
How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Hudsonville Michigan
Qualifying for assisted living in Hudsonville, Michigan, involves several steps and considerations to ensure that residents receive the appropriate level of care they need. If you or a loved one is considering making the transition to an assisted living facility, here are the key requirements and tips to guide you through the process.
Firstly, an assessment of the individual's care needs is essential. This typically includes a health evaluation by a medical professional, which will help determine if assisted living is the appropriate setting. The assessment will look at the individual's ability to perform activities of daily living (ADLs), such as bathing, dressing, and medication management.
Secondly, financial qualification is an important aspect. Assisted living costs can vary, and it's crucial to have a clear understanding of one's financial resources. In Hudsonville, as in other parts of Michigan, individuals may utilize government programs like Medicaid to help cover the costs of assisted living if they meet certain income and asset criteria. The Michigan Choice Waiver Program is one such initiative that provides financial assistance to eligible seniors, allowing them to receive care in an assisted living facility instead of a nursing home.
To qualify, applicants must meet the program's requirements, which include being a Michigan resident, meeting the financial eligibility for Medicaid, and requiring a nursing home level of care. It’s advisable to contact a local Medicaid office in Hudsonville to get assistance with the application process and understand the full scope of benefits available.
Lastly, it's beneficial to visit several assisted living facilities in Hudsonville to find the best fit. During these visits, ask about their admission process and any specific requirements they might have. Some facilities may have their own set of criteria in addition to state regulations.
By thoroughly evaluating care needs, understanding financial resources, and exploring government assistance programs, qualifying for assisted living in Hudsonville can be a smooth and manageable process.
Advantages and Disadvantages: Assisted Living in Hudsonville Michigan
Assisted living in Hudsonville, Michigan, offers a unique blend of independence and care to its residents, catering to those who may need assistance with daily activities but still wish to maintain a sense of autonomy. This type of living arrangement has its own set of advantages and disadvantages that are worth considering.
One of the primary advantages is the provision of personalized care. Assisted living facilities in Hudsonville are designed to offer help with daily tasks such as bathing, dressing, and medication management, all while promoting as much independence as possible. Residents can enjoy the comfort of their own private or semi-private living spaces, often equipped with kitchenettes and accessible bathrooms, which fosters a homelike atmosphere.
Another significant benefit is the community aspect. Social interaction is encouraged through organized activities, communal dining areas, and shared spaces that foster a sense of belonging and help prevent the loneliness that can sometimes accompany aging. Additionally, safety is a top priority, with features like emergency call systems and 24-hour staff availability providing peace of mind for both residents and their families.
However, there are also disadvantages to consider. The cost of assisted living can be a financial burden for some, as it is typically more expensive than independent living due to the level of care provided. While many facilities offer a range of amenities, the expense can be a significant factor in the decision-making process.
Furthermore, the transition to an assisted living environment can be challenging for some individuals who are attached to their homes and may feel a loss of privacy and independence. Adjusting to a new living situation often takes time, and some may find it difficult to adapt to the communal aspects of assisted living.
In conclusion, while assisted living in Hudsonville offers a supportive environment with numerous benefits, it is essential to weigh these against the potential drawbacks to make an informed decision that best suits the needs and preferences of the individual considering this living option.
